.opening,body,html{height:100%;width:100%}*,::after,::before{box-sizing:border-box;padding:0;margin:0;background:0 0;text-decoration:none;outline:0;font-family:inherit;font-size:inherit;line-height:inherit;font-weight:inherit;font-style:inherit;color:inherit;border:none;list-style: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.date,.text{padding:0 1rem}:active,:visited{color:inherit}@font-face{font-family:Campton;src:url("fonts/ffa2a131-998b-4420-8aa9-7526939a00ef.woff2") format("woff2")}@font-face{font-family:"Didot LT";src:url("fonts/650d0d58-e300-4679-853a-3e756a508990.woff2") format("woff2")}:root{--c-bg:hsl(1, 17%, 95%);--c-text:hsl(0, 15%, 55%);--font-family:"Campton",sans-serif;--font-serif:"Didot LT",Didot,serif;--font-size:17px;--font-lineheight:26px;--font-weight:400;--font-style:normal;--font-scale-xs:0.79;--font-scale-s:0.889;--font-scale-m:1.125;--font-scale-l:1.226;--font-scale-xl:1.2;--font-scale-xxl:3;--l-regular:24rem;--l-wide:36rem;--l-archive:37rem;--l-archive-wide:57rem;--l-text:19rem;font-size:var(--font-lineheight);font-family:var(--font-family);font-weight:var(--font-weight);font-style:var(--font-style);background:var(--c-bg);color:var(--c-text)}::-moz-selection{background:var(--c-text);color:var(--c-bg)}::selection{background:var(--c-text);color:var(--c-bg)}body *,html *{font-size:var(--font-size);line-height:1rem;letter-spacing:.05em}body{overflow:auto}.opening{display:-webkit-box;display:-webkit-flex;display:flex;position:relative}.opening::after,.opening::before{content:"";display:block;width:90%;height:35%;position:absolute;background-size:contain;background-repeat:no-repeat;left:0;right:0;margin:0 auto}.opening::before{background-position:center bottom;top:5vmin;background-image:url("../images/illustration_1.jpg")}.opening::after{background-position:center top;bottom:5vmin;background-image:url("../images/illustration_2.jpg")}.opening-title{display:-webkit-box;display:-webkit-flex;display:flex;align-items:center;text-align:center;margin:auto;font-family:var(--font-serif);font-size:10vmin}.date,.text{margin-bottom:3rem}.opening-title span{display:inline;font-size:inherit;letter-spacing:.2em}.opening-title img{margin-top:0;margin-right:.5em;margin-bottom:0;height:3rem}.opening-title span:nth-child(3){margin:0 .3em}.text{text-align:center;text-transform:uppercase;margin-top:3rem}.text .optional br{display:none}@media (min-width:1000px){.text .optional br{display:initial}}.text p:not(:last-child){margin-bottom:1rem}.opening+.text{margin-top:0}.text-big{font-size:calc(var(--font-size) * var(--font-scale-xl));line-height:1.2rem;letter-spacing:.1em}.text-big:not(:last-child){margin-bottom:.5rem}.text a{background:-webkit-linear-gradient(bottom,var(--c-text) 1px,transparent 1px);background:linear-gradient(to top,var(--c-text) 1px,transparent 1px);background-size:0 100%;background-repeat:no-repeat;background-position:center center;-webkit-transition-property:color,background-size;transition-property:color,background-size;-webkit-transition-duration:.3s;transition-duration:.3s;-webkit-transition-timing-function:ease-in-out;transition-timing-function:ease-in-out}.text a:hover{background-size:100% 100%}.date{margin-top:4rem}.date-image,.illustration{display:block;width:100%;height:auto}@media (min-width:500px){.date-image{height:2rem;width:auto;margin:0 auto}}.date-caption{position:absolute;top:-999999px;left:-999999px}.illustration-container{max-width:22rem;margin:2rem auto;padding:0 1rem}.illustration-container-small{max-width:16rem}.illustration-container-medium{max-width:18rem}.illustration-container-final{max-width:8rem;margin-bottom:0;padding-bottom:2rem}@media (min-width:700px){.opening+.text,.text{margin-top:4rem}:root{--font-size:21px;--font-lineheight:34px;--font-scale-xl:1.35}.text{margin-bottom:4rem}.illustration-container{margin:4rem auto}.illustration-container-final{padding-bottom:4rem}}